## Account Recovery — Trailnote Offline Mode

When a surveyor's Trailnote app has been offline for 30+ days, their local credentials expire and sync refuses to resume. Don't make them wipe the device — all their unsynced field data lives there! Instead, open the support console, pick "Offline Reinstate," and enter their handle. The console will ask for the support team's shared recovery passphrase before issuing a reinstatement token. Use the one below.

unlock words, bagaf-fajeg: zorael-kelax-fraath-quenix-eliok-sileth-aldmir-wenir-druiel

Hey Marek,

Quick heads-up for your security pass: we fixed the non-deterministic sort in the Sortfinch report builder. Rows with equal keys now keep insertion order, which matters because the old behavior could shuffle redacted rows next to unredacted ones in mixed-permission exports. Nothing in the access-control path changed, but you'll probably want to re-run your diff checks against last week's fixtures anyway. Let us know if anything smells off. The build token for this candidate follows.

session token of yahof-bajeg = htk9_0d43d44ed

## Runbook: Account Recovery — Planner Regression Incidents

Scope: Pellgrove DB accounts locked during the Ashvane query planner regression.

Steps: Confirm lockout in the Tindery console. Re-enable the account flag. Revert planner hints to baseline. Verify with a smoke query.

If the admin vault is sealed, unseal it with the recovery passphrase given below.

vault phrase of bagaf-kajeg = jorath-feniel-briir-siliel-ralix